CVE-2008-3341
Last modified
CVE-2008-3341 is a vulnerability of currently unknown severity. Multiple SQL injection vulnerabilities in search_result.cfm in Jobbex JobSite allow remote attackers to execute arbitrary SQL commands via the (1) jobcountryid and (2) jobstateid parameters. NOTE: the provenance of this information is unknown; the details are obtained solely from third party information.. EPSS estimates a 1.10% chance of exploitation in the next 30 days.
